Inflation falls to a 7-month low in December

Inflation hit a 7-month low in December coming in at 4.5% year-on-year from 5.2% reaching the mid-point of the Sarb's target range of 3-6%. CPI is expected to moderate further this month due to fuel cuts - the current level however will allow more flexibility to deal with price shocks…
